The following rules (Version 1.2.0) of behaviour must be observed when working on the premises of St. Kilian Distillers GmbH:
General:
- I agree that in all work I carry out for St.Kilian Distillers GmbH, the highest priority is given to compliance with food safety and product quality
- I commit myself to take all necessary measures during my work to prevent food contamination. This includes, but is not limited to, the use of appropriate protective clothing, strict adherence to hygiene guidelines and the avoidance of contamination by materials or tools
- I ensure that my work is carried out with the utmost care and attention. This includes in particular the avoidance of damage to equipment or infrastructure. If damage does occur, I undertake to report it immediately
- I am aware that violations of these rules of behaviour may result in disciplinary action, including termination of my employment with St. Kilian Distillers GmbH and legal consequences
Hygiene:
- During production times, the consumption of food is only permitted in kitchens 106 and 127
- Consumption of drinks in the production area is only permitted from non-breakable bottles / cups / glasses
- Smoking / vaping, other use of tobacco is strictly prohibited in the building. Outside, smoking is only permitted in the designated areas
- After leaving the social rooms, sanitary facilities and after smoking, hands must be thoroughly cleaned with soap before entering the production area
- Medicine / medication of any kind may only be taken outside the production area and only if there is no impairment due to the effect.
- In the event of injuries, please report to the signposted first aiders. Cuts and abrasions must be covered with a coloured, waterproof (different from the product colour) plaster/bandage. In the event of injuries to the hands, work is only permitted with disposable nitrile gloves
- Stay at home if you feel unwell or are ill, even after travelling abroad. If there is a suspicion or confirmation of suffering from one of the diseases listed in ยง42 para. 1 IFSG, the technical manager must be contacted
Fire protection:
- Dust, vapour, heat-generating work (e.g. drilling, welding, abrasive cutting, etc.) must be reported in advance. The fire alarms in the affected areas will then be switched off
- The completion of this work must also be signalled and the detectors are then switched on again
- The technical manager must be contacted in the event of any problems in this regard
- While the fire detectors are switched off, increased attention must be paid
